St Colman's NS 5k hits the road again

The members of the parents association at St Colman’s NS in Mullingar “were absolutely delighted to welcome all the boys and girls of St Colman’s NS, along with their families, for what was a fantastic day” – their 5k, on Sunday.

Speaking on behalf of the group, chairperson Dearbhla O’Sullivan said: “This was the first time this race was held since 2019 and we are so glad that everybody enjoyed themselves.

“A huge thank you to all the staff of St Colman’s, and especially the members of the parents association who, along with principal Ger Beehan and deputy principal Amy Hamill, did Trojan work in getting everything organised for today.

“The boys and girls and their parents stepped up to provide us with delicious baked goodies, which tasted all the better after a run in the sunshine.

“Huge congratulations to our race winners and runners-up in each category, from U8 right up. It was a fantastic family day and really showcased the wonderful school spirit at St Colman’s NS.”
